The cheapest way to get from Hvar to Prague is to ferry and bus via Trogir which costs 2 000 Kč - 3 400 Kč and takes 19h 21m.
The fastest way to get from Hvar to Prague is to ferry and fly which takes 5h 56m and costs 2 200 Kč - 7 500 Kč.
The distance between Hvar and Prague is 829 km.
The best way to get from Hvar to Prague without a car is to ferry and bus which takes 18h 5m and costs 2 000 Kč - 3 800 Kč.
It takes approximately 5h 56m to get from Hvar to Prague, including transfers.

There is no direct connection from Hvar to Prague. However, you can take the ferry to Port of Split, walk to Split Bus Station, take the shuttle to Split Airport, walk to Split Airport (SPU) airport, fly to Václav Havel Airport Prague (PRG), walk to Václav Havel Airport T1, take the line 59 train to Nádraží Veleslavín, walk to Nádraží Veleslavín, then take the subway to Staroměstská. Alternatively, you can take a ferry from Hvar to Prague via Port Of Split and Split, Autobusni Kolodvor in around 18h 5m.
